What does the high-speed train emoji mean?

Meaning reviewed and updated July 2026 Β· Unicode data from the official Unicode Standard

High-speed trains are often associated with rapid transit and efficient travel, symbolizing a fast and modern way to get from one place to another, and are also used figuratively to represent speed and momentum in various aspects of life, such as career advancement or personal growth. Literally, the πŸš„ emoji represents a high-speed train, a type of railway vehicle designed for rapid transportation, often traveling at speeds over 200 kilometers per hour. In slang, the πŸš„ emoji can be used to express that something is moving quickly or is high-tech. This emoji is also closely related to the concept of the shinkansen, Japan's famous bullet train.

How the high-speed train emoji is used

Texting and social media platforms like Twitter and Instagram are common places where the πŸš„ emoji is used, often to convey excitement or anticipation for an upcoming trip, or to express admiration for the technology and engineering behind high-speed trains. The tone is usually informal and conversational, with a touch of enthusiasm and modernity, and is popular among younger generations who are familiar with the concept of high-speed rail. On TikTok, the πŸš„ emoji might be used in captions for videos showcasing train travel or futuristic transportation systems, while in comments, it can be used to react to posts about travel or technology.

high-speed train Emoji Details

EmojiπŸš„
Namehigh-speed train
CategoryTravel & Places
CodepointsU+1F684
Shortcode:high_speed_train:
Emoji version0.6
Unicode version0.6
